Remember, City ordinance requires that Denver businesses remove snow from their sidewalks within four (4) hours after a snowstorm ends and Denver residents remove snow from their sidewalks within 24 hours after a snowstorm ends. Violators that fail to remove snow from public sidewalks can receive fines ranging from $150 to $999. These teens are a group of people who are often forgotten this time of year. With help from presenting sponsor Councilman Rick Garcia, donations from the Highlands Mommies and many neighborhood businesses we were able to put together 200 reusable gift bags, filled with school supplies, hygiene items, candy, and gifts. We gathered a group of families together at the Hai Bar in Highlands Square to help us fill 200 bags and to be video taped singing some Christmas Carols, this dvd will be sent to neighborhood nursing homes as a way to brighten the holidays for some of our neighborhood's grandparents. We had a great turn out and the event was a huge success!&lt;br /&gt;Thank you to all of our generous sponsors and to the families who came out to help us fill the bags and sing!
